Medical consultation

Concerned about your health? We offer you three different consultations led by a doctor who are available from Monday to Friday. Choose the one that best matches your situation.

 

Why consult?

  • To obtain a first medical opinion and personalized advice
  • To be referred to specialists (gynecologist, dermatologist, etc.) and get recommendations
  • To get a voucher for free HIV testing

Please note that during a consultation with our doctor, you will not be provided with:

  • physical examination
  • clinical check-up
  • prescription
  • medical certificate

Rates

Consultations are free of charge.

Why consult?

  • Get a diagnosis for an illness and its treatment (prescription)

  • Receive follow-up care for a chronic condition (diabetes, hypertension, etc.)

Thanks to:

  • Physical examination and clinical assessment
  • Tests: blood tests, urine tests, X-rays, etc.

Rates

Consultations are billed according to the standard TARMED tariff (a minimum of CHF 69 and up to CHF 190 or more, depending on the examination the doctor needs to perform based on the health issue presented). The costs are reimbursed according to your health insurance contract and once your deductible has been reached.

Why consult?

  • To diagnose a simple health issue (e.g., urinary tract infection, mild pain, upper respiratory infections, etc.) and obtain treatment

  • To renew a prescription for a medication you usually take

  • To request blood tests and X-rays

  • To obtain a sick leave certificate

Rates

CHF 30. The fees are reimbursed by all health insurance providers (except managed-care network plans), depending on your insurance contract. These services remain subject to the deductible and co-payment.
